Transaction 3ab596743f153194168e320fd36032358bd52cdc78b5c750a40609439f2fbc55
1 Input
1 Output
-
3ab596743f153194168e320fd36032358bd52cdc78b5c750a40609439f2fbc55:0
- value
- 9951424
- script pubkey
- OP_0 OP_PUSHBYTES_20 15d3465ee25235fd8200028f5b82c0adac07356a
- address
- bc1qzhf5vhhz2g6lmqsqq284hqkq4kkqwdt2lyy5t6